With an estimated 8,000 deaths per year in the United States from complications of UCA, an initial goal of 50% reduction of loss is possible. To achieve this goal requires the recognition by the obstetrical community of the issue. Recent research into circadian rhythms may help explain why UCA stillbirth is an event between 2:00 a.m. and 4:00 a.m. Melatonin has been described as stimulating uterine contractions through the M2 receptor. Melatonin secretion from the pineal gland begins around 10:00 p.m. and peaks to 60 pg at 3:00 a.m. Serum levels decline to below 10 pg by 6:00 a.m. Uterine stimulation intensifies during maternal sleep, which can be overwhelming to a compromised fetus, especially one experiencing intermittent umbilical cord compression due to UCA. It is now time for the focus to be on screening for UCA, managing UCA prenatally, and delivery of the baby in distress defined by the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ists as a heart rate of 90 beats per minute for 1 minute on a recorded nonstress test. The ability of ultrasound and mag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) to visualize UCA is well documented. The 18-20 week ultrasound review should include the umbilical cord, its characteristics, and description of its placental and fetal attachment. Bettye Wilson, MEd, R.T.(R)(CT), RDMS, FASRT Fellow of The American Society of Radiologic Technologist recommended in RADIOLOGIC TECHNOLOGY March/April 2008, Vol. 79/No. 4 pg 333S-345S That an umbilical cord evaluation with sonography should include the appearance, composition, location, and size (and length) of the cord. In addition: Abnormal Insertion (in the placenta and fetus) Vasa Previa Abnormal composition (single umbilical artery) Cysts, Masses Hematoma Umbilical Cord Thrombosis Coiling (helices), collapse, knotting and prolapsed (funic presentation) Cord Events: Although many stillbirths are attributed to a cord accident, this diagnosis should be made with caution. Cord abnormalities, including a Nuchal Cord, are found in approximately 30% of normal births and may be an incidental finding. (American College of Obstetrics and Gynecology Practice Bulletin 2009) According to NICHD's recent stillbirth study, UCA is a significant cause of mortality (10%). This finding is in agreement with other international UCA studies. (Bukowski et al. 2011) These histologic criteria identify cases of cord accident as a cause of stillbirth with very high specificity. (Dilated fetal vessels, thrombosis in fetal vessels, avascular placental villi.) (Pediatr Dev Pathol 2012) Finally, defining the morbidity (injury) of cord compression, such as fetal neurologic injury or heart injury identified with umbilical cord blood troponin T levels or pulmonary injury, is the next major area of investigation.

Document from the year 2008 in the subject Law - European and International Law, Intellectual Properties, Universit Paris-Sorbonne (Paris IV), 81 entries in the bibliography, language: English, abstract: About 5.4 million people have been killed in the wars in the Democratic Republic of Congo (D.R.C.), the former Zaire. 45,000 die every month and hundreds of thousands of women have been raped here in recent years. Wartime rapes are anything but new and have been employed not only to terrorize the population but also as weapon of genocide in Rwanda, Bosnia and Darfur. The Eastern Congolese provinces of North and South Kivu have been affected by particular gruesome acts of violence and thousands of victims suffer from rape-induced fistulae, ruptures of the walls which separate the victim's vagina from her rectum. According to UN staff and doctors in the region, all armed groups in the region are involved in rapes and despite the 2002 Pretoria Accord which put an official end to the war, attacks and rapes continue to this very day. Many survivors are forced out of their homes and their families abandoned and left to fend for themselves. Therefore, apart from medical treatment and psychological counseling, there is a strong demand for justice. But due to the weak position of women in Congolese society, justice is much harder to get by than medical treatment. Although the Congolese Penal Code and Military Penal Code penalize these crimes, the reaction by the Congolese government to the atrocities remains insufficient, making a solution based on Congolese criminal law unlikely.
